متن کاملAn Efficient Lock Protocol for Home-Based Lazy Release Consistency
Home-based Lazy Release Consistency (HLRC) shows poor performance on lock based applications because of two reasons: (1) a whole page is fetched on a page fault while actual modification is much smaller, and (2) a home is at the fixed location while access pattern is migratory. متن کاملPerformance Evaluation of Two Home - Based Lazy Release Consistency Protocols
This paper investigates the performance of shared virtual memory protocols on large-scale multicomputers.
